This volume is an interdisciplinary collection of contributions that address the question of how space is conceptualised and constituted through historical and religious claims to land ownership and how dispossession is enacted and theorised in changing property relations. In particular, the essays engage with the postcolonial critique of land ownership and provide a much-needed contextualisation of the ways in which histories of divine possession, empire, settler colonialism, slavery and the dispossession of indigenous peoples inform contemporary practices of land ownership.

The book brings together perspectives from the fields of religious studies, history, Philosophy, legal history, economics and sociology and thus makes an important contribution to linking theory and practice in the critique of contemporary property regimes in Europe and North America. At the same time, it provides methodological suggestions for basing theoretical discussions on a differentiated understanding of the past.
